Jalandhar District Population 2011–2026: Religion | Literacy | Density | Sex Ratio

The Jalandhar district of Punjab had a population of 21,93,590 approx. in 2011 and it is expected to grow steadily to reach a population of 24,68,870 by 2026. It has an area of 2,624 sq km and population density of 836 persons per sq km. The sex ratio is close to 916 females per 1000 males and the literacy rate is around 82.48. The child sex ratio is 874 girls per 1000 boys. The major religion is Hindu with 63.56% and Punjabi is the main language spoken by most people. The district population is 52.93% urban and 47.07% rural, and 4,61,635 accounts for the total households in the district.There are a total of 4,61,635 households in the district.

Population and Growth Data

Year Population Growth
19017,21,579-
19116,31,216-12.58%
19216,47,5282.59%
19317,43,09814.77%
19418,87,49719.45%
19518,30,275-6.45%
19619,82,29618.31%
197111,75,22819.70%
198114,06,96019.69%
199116,49,55217.30%
200119,62,76118.96%
201121,93,59011.76%

Religion Data

Religion Population Share
Hindu13,94,32963.56%
Sikh7,18,36332.75%
Muslim30,2331.38%
Christian26,0161.19%
Buddhist11,3850.52%
Religion not stated8,4480.39%
Jain4,0110.18%
Other religions and persuasions8050.04%
